CONTROLS

De®nitions

ANALOG SIGNAL Ð An analog signal varies in propor- tion to the monitored source. It quanti®es values between operating limits. (Example: A temperature sensor is an ana- log device because its resistance changes in proportion to the temperature, generating many values.)

DIGITAL SIGNAL Ð A digital (discrete) signal is a 2-position representation of the value of a monitored source. (Example: A switch is a digital device because it only in- dicates whether a value is above or below a set point or bound- ary by generating an on/off, high/low, or open/closed signal.)

VOLATILE MEMORY Ð Volatile memory is memory in- capable of being sustained if power is lost and subsequently restored.

The memories of the PSIO and LID modules are vola- tile. If the battery in a module is removed or damaged, all programming will be lost.

General Ð The 17EX externally geared open-drive cen- trifugal liquid chiller contains a microprocessor-based con- trol center that monitors and controls all operations of the chiller. The microprocessor control system matches the cool- ing capacity of the chiller to the cooling load while provid- ing state-of-the-art chiller protection. The system controls cooling load within the set point plus the deadband by sens- ing the leaving chilled water or brine temperature and regu- lating the inlet guide vane via a mechanically linked actua- tor motor. The guide vane is a variable ¯ow prewhirl assembly that controls the refrigeration effect in the cooler by regu- lating the amount of refrigerant vapor ¯ow into the com- pressor. An increase in guide vane opening increases capac- ity. A decrease in guide vane opening decreases capacity. Chiller protection is provided by the processor which monitors the digital and analog inputs and executes capacity overrides or safety shutdowns, if required.
